1. RTP (Return to Player): 95.82%

The RTP of Crazy Box is 95.82%, indicating that, on average, players can expect to receive 95.82 coins back for every 100 coins wagered. This translates to an expected house edge of 4.18%, which is fairly standard in the gaming industry. While not the highest RTP available, it provides a reasonable return expectation over extended play sessions.

Simple Expected Return Calculation:

Assuming a player spins 1,000 times with a 1-coin bet (considering the average min bet is slightly replaced):

(total wager = 1,000 coins)

With the RTP of 95.82%, the expected return would be:

1,000 * 0.9582 = 958.2 coins returned

Expected loss = 41.8 coins

This means that, while the expected returns show a loss, actual play could vary widely, with potential big swings based on luck.
